The TELC German B1 certificate is an internationally recognized qualification that assesses a candidate's German language proficiency at the B1 level, as specified by the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). Whether you are seeking to work or study in a German-speaking nation or wishing to improve your interaction skills, obtaining this certificate shows you have actually effectively gotten intermediate-level German abilities. zertifikat telc b1 (The European Language Certificates) is a prestigious language testing system that provides accreditations in over 10 different languages, including German. The exams are designed with particular CEFR levels in mind, ensuring that your language abilities are objectively evaluated based on global standards.

The B1 certificate tests your capability to communicate efficiently in familiar, daily situations. This level demonstrates that you can manage most typical language circumstances in both composed and spoken formats. A TELC German B1 certificate is often a requirement for people seeking residency in Germany or wishing to operate in positions that require fundamental interaction skills. Lots of universities and immigration workplaces likewise recognize this accreditation.

Exam Structure and Focus Areas
The TELC German B1 exam is divided into two primary areas: Written Exam and Oral Exam

1. Written Exam
The written area examines your listening, reading, and composing abilities.

Listening (Approx. 20 Minutes): You are needed to understand discussions and statements in daily German.
Checking Out (90 Minutes): This area analyzes your ability to comprehend written texts, varying from news article to everyday correspondence like e-mails.
Composing (30 Minutes): You require to produce a written piece, such as a brief letter or e-mail, showing precise grammar and vocabulary.
2. Oral Exam.
The oral exam normally lasts around 15 minutes. It evaluates your capability to speak German in circumstances like presenting yourself, Telc B1 discussing familiar subjects, and reacting to concerns in a clear and succinct way. Preparation time of 15-20 minutes is usually provided before the speaking test commences.

Why is the TELC German B1 Certificate Important?
1. Acknowledgment and Credibility
As the TELC German B1 certification follows CEFR requirements, it is commonly accepted not just throughout Germany but also in other German-speaking countries such as Austria and Switzerland. Employers, academic organizations, and migration authorities depend on TELC certificates as proof of a prospect's language abilities.

2. Helps with Integration
If you are preparing to reside in Germany long-term, obtaining the b1 prüfung kaufen level is an essential action toward integration. The German federal government often requires non-native speakers to show language proficiency at this level for irreversible residency or citizenship applications.

3. Opens Job Opportunities
Numerous firms in German-speaking countries choose employing people who can interact successfully in German. While greater levels of efficiency may be required for technical or scholastic fields, the B1 level is normally adequate for customer care, retail, and entry-level administrative roles.

4. Supports Academic Pursuits
For students preparing to attend preparatory courses (Studienkolleg) or employment training programs in Germany, the B1 certificate is a significant benefit. While universities typically require higher language levels like B2 or C1 for direct admission, having a B1 certification establishes a strong foundation for progression.

Preparing for the TELC German B1 Exam
1. Understand the Format
Acquaint yourself with the structure of the test by reviewing sample exams and practice questions. This will assist you comprehend what to anticipate on test day and handle your time efficiently.

2. Construct Your Vocabulary
Having the ability to speak fluently and write clearly at the B1 level requires constructing an extensive active vocabulary. Concentrate on subjects like travel, family, pastimes, work, and daily social interactions.

3. Practice Regularly
Constant practice is important. Participate in speaking, listening, and composing activities every day. Watching German TV shows, listening to podcasts, and checking out short articles can likewise improve your understanding skills.

4. Join a Preparation Course
Numerous language schools and online platforms provide TELC preparation courses. These classes typically provide structured guidance, mock tests, and individualized feedback to help you achieve your desired results.

5. Usage Self-Study Resources

Cost and Registration
The cost of the TELC German B1 exam varies depending upon your test center, normally ranging between EUR100 and EUR200. Examinations are held year-round at qualified test centers worldwide. Registration requirements and deadlines might vary, so talk to your local test center for particular details.
